Drove the Comptech SC TSX today
Just drove the supercharged Comptech TSX... let me say DAMMMN that thing is awesome. If that kit is ever released I'll definately be first in line. I drove it around for a while, first has issues with traction (even with the 18 X 8 Works) and second chirps in. I don't like the TSX's drive by wire system now, only because it takes a lot of the fun out of this car. I pulled from a stoplight, through first it was even due to traction issues, but when second gear caught (I was about a car and a half ahead at that point) it caught me and passed me like I was standing still. Within 2 seconds it went from a car and a half behind to 3 cars ahead.
Two thumbs up!

A LSD and softer compound tyres should improve acceleration, putting the power down more efficiently. In fact, I'd probably attribute traction loss almost entirely to tyres without being subjective to how much torque is increased.

Traction loss was due to many things, tires, torque, launch RPM, etc. I was referring to the drive by wire's introduction of a phase lag into the system, creating an effective lag that is much too noticeable. This really was independent of the Comptech car, as I was stating my experience with it's response delay to be unsatisfactory in my car.
